This video shows you how to install new front brake pads and rotors from TRQ on your 2005-2015 Toyota Tacoma. Brake pads wear out over time, much like tires, and need replacing, on average, every 50,000 miles, with variations depending on driving habits and environment. Brake rotors may also need to be replaced if they are warped or grooved. Often, it’s safer and more cost effective to replace pads and rotors at the same time. Squealing or grinding noises, or wheel vibration are all symptoms of worn brakes.

Estimated installation time for a professional technician is approximately: 48 minutes
